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

chore(main): release platform 0.4.0 #100

Conversation

opentdf-automation[bot]
Copy link
Contributor

🤖 I have created a release beep boop

0.4.0 (2024-12-04)

⚠ BREAKING CHANGES

  • yaml config for kas (#52)

Features

  • ability to add extra service definitions (#62) (e35695e)
  • ability to load envFrom a configmap or secret (e35695e)
  • ability to set extra environment variables (e35695e)
  • add ability to merge custom volumes and volumeMount templates (0666d4f)
  • add cors configuration support (#60) (f175e88)
  • add entity resolution service to values (#41) (3eb303d)
  • Add pod disruption budget capability (#87) (549a779)
  • common: add templating for hostaliases (#66) (efc773c)
  • initial platform helm chart setup (#1) (a3eba3f)
  • platform configuration template for child charts (#76) (02f8839)
  • platform mode and global sdk configuration support (#73) (0666d4f)
  • platform: add headless service (#55) (c7c8611)
  • platform: additional certs projected volumes (#57) (d1205b4)
  • platform: propagate playground setting to platform (#56) (2aaa497)
  • yaml config for kas (#52) (e5b4c1a)

Bug Fixes

  • add auth skew configuration (0666d4f)
  • add optional required field for db to drive db configuration (#78) (81f64ca)
  • allow enablement of pprof in service (#68) (060f9f6)
  • change file paths to be more generic (#42) (acf9487)
  • change version (#20) (5a22524)
  • changes service to http2 from http (#32) (a548707)
  • ci: Add public_client_id to server.auth config (#89) (6829c87)
  • core: deprecate keycloak-from-config (#81) (da5a685), closes #80
  • correct h2c service appProtocol (#77) (25a1ae8)
  • enable extra keycloak features needed by platform (#63) (d877541)
  • only mount keycloak cert if ingress and tls enabled (5cacbb8)
  • platform chart readme (#22) (fc0b23c)
  • platform optional health check (#28) (4a977d1)
  • platform: extra certs overwriting files in /etc/ssl/certs (#70) (5cacbb8)
  • platform: update crypto provider and kas keyring configuration (d1205b4)
  • platform: update kas key paths to new config format (#48) (9c4bd5b)
  • port naming/app protocol tls.enabled (#90) (613f67e)
  • remove container command (#39) (0af92ca)
  • remove defaultMode on trusted-certs volume (5cacbb8)
  • set appVersion to nightly (#37) (54ec9b1)
  • set appVersion to v0.4.32 (#92) (f94d5dc)
  • set default security context values for container (5cacbb8)
  • set pod security context defaults (5cacbb8)
  • support openshift compatibility for service appProtocol (81f64ca)
  • sync service configuration with platform (#64) (63dc6ba)
  • trusted-cert volume and mount defined when not expected (#75) (73cde0e)
  • unquote cors config values (#61) (1bb67ff)
  • update postgres chart version 16.2.5 (#95) (768c407)
  • upgrade keycloak chart to 22.1.1 (0666d4f)
  • upgrade postgresql chart to 15.5.21 (0666d4f)

Miscellaneous Chores


This PR was generated with Release Please. See documentation.

@opentdf-automation opentdf-automation bot force-pushed the release-please--branches--main--components--platform branch from 78b4990 to 47f0111 Compare December 4, 2024 23:25
@opentdf-automation opentdf-automation bot requested a review from a team as a code owner December 4, 2024 23:25
@strantalis strantalis closed this Dec 4,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

deprecate keycloak-from-config provisioner
1 participant